3.19 Clock Tolerance Compensation (CTC)
The XAUI interface is defined to allow for separate clock domains on each side of the link. Though the reference clocks
for two devices on a XAUI link have the same specified frequencies, there are slight differences within those limits
that, if not compensated for, lead to over- or underruns of the FIFOs on the receive data path. The TLK3114SA device
provides compensation for these differences in reference clock frequencies via the insertion or the removal of /R/
characters on all channels, as shown in Figure 3â15 and Figure 3â16. Bit 11 of MDIO register 16 allows enabling of
the CTC, as noted in Table 3â18.
